src/hg/makeDb/metaTblUpdate/makefile 1.2
1.2 2010/03/18 23:38:36 tdreszer
Added metaTblPrint and keeping in one directory for now.
Index: src/hg/makeDb/metaTblUpdate/makefile
===================================================================
RCS file: /projects/compbio/cvsroot/kent/src/hg/makeDb/metaTblUpdate/makefile,v
retrieving revision 1.1
retrieving revision 1.2
diff -b -B -U 4 -r1.1 -r1.2
--- src/hg/makeDb/metaTblUpdate/makefile 18 Mar 2010 01:56:26 -0000 1.1
+++ src/hg/makeDb/metaTblUpdate/makefile 18 Mar 2010 23:38:36 -0000 1.2
@@ -3,17 +3,29 @@
L += -lm $(MYSQLLIBS)
MYLIBDIR = ../../../lib/$(MACHTYPE)
MYLIBS = $(MYLIBDIR)/jkhgap.a $(MYLIBDIR)/jkweb.a
-O = metaTblUpdate.o
-A = metaTblUpdate
+UPDATE_A = metaTblUpdate
+PRINT_A = metaTblPrint
+UPDATE_O = ${UPDATE_A}.o
+PRINT_O = ${PRINT_A}.o
-metaTblUpdate: $O ${MYLIBS}
- ${CC} ${COPT} ${CFLAGS} -o ${BINDIR}/${A} $O ${MYLIBS} $L
- ${STRIP} ${BINDIR}/${A}${EXE}
+all: metaTblUpdate metaTblPrint
-compile: ${O} ${MYLIBS}
- ${CC} ${COPT} ${CFLAGS} -o ${A} $O ${MYLIBS} $L
+metaTblUpdate: ${UPDATE_O} ${MYLIBS}
+ ${CC} ${COPT} ${CFLAGS} -o ${BINDIR}/${UPDATE_A} ${UPDATE_O} ${MYLIBS} $L
+ ${STRIP} ${BINDIR}/${UPDATE_A}${EXE}
-clean:
- rm -f $O
+metaTblPrint: ${PRINT_O} ${MYLIBS}
+ ${CC} ${COPT} ${CFLAGS} -o ${BINDIR}/${PRINT_A} ${PRINT_O} ${MYLIBS} $L
+ ${STRIP} ${BINDIR}/${PRINT_A}${EXE}
+
+lib:
+ cd ${MYLIBDIR} && ${MAKE}
+
+compile: ${UPDATE_O} ${PRINT_O} ../../../lib/${MACHTYPE}/jkweb.a
+ ${CC} ${COPT} -o ${UPDATE_A} ${UPDATE_O} ${MYLIBS} $L
+ ${CC} ${COPT} -o ${PRINT_A} ${PRINT_O} ${MYLIBS} $L
+
+clean::
+ rm -f ${UPDATE_A} ${PRINT_A} ${UPDATE_O} ${PRINT_O}